The best way to obtain maximum heat from a wood-burning stove is to select logs that are kiln-dried and then divided, stacked, and cut in a proper manner prior to burning. The reason for Wood Burner Stoves Uk this is that green, unseasoned wood requires a lot energy to move the water contained in the logs via evaporation before it can generate any heat. This means that it takes double the amount of logs in order to generate the same amount of heat as kiln-dried, well seasoned wood.

The air pollution that is produced by stoves, open fireplaces and other wood heaters are harmful. It can cause heart and lung issues as well as dementia and pregnancy loss. This is due to tiny particles known as PM2.5 which are produced when coal and wood burn.

Thankfully, this type of air pollution can be avoided by using cleaner burning stoves, ensuring that the flue stays clean and only dry wood is used. To minimize the chance of a chimney fire, those who have installed stoves in their homes must be able to have their chimneys examined by a professional at least once per year.

The right wood can increase the efficiency of your stove. Oak and hickory have a greater capacity for heating per pound than softwoods and pine. It is also recommended to only burn seasoned, dried firewood. Dry or damp firewood can produce creosote, which can obscure the glass, clog the flue, and be hazardous to your health.
